Transaction 81daf354ab902884dbbc2dc051eea94cd2255f77ca80070b9cc2b6566a1a25a3
1 Input
1 Output
-
81daf354ab902884dbbc2dc051eea94cd2255f77ca80070b9cc2b6566a1a25a3:0
- value
- 8505820
- script pubkey
- OP_0 OP_PUSHBYTES_32 462e982bcb422743c053e7d4e3c479311cfbef2b336a197dc69ae63e043ccef8
- address
- bc1qgchfs27tggn58sznul2w83rexyw0hmetxd4pjlwxntnruppuemuqu2qlp6